Buckhead is Atlanta's affluent uptown district, north of Midtown, built around the Peachtree Road spine and the point where GA-400 ties into I-85 near the top of the Connector. GA-400 is North Fulton's main artery, and the speed differentials near its exits and the I-85 junction drive rear-end chains and multi-car wrecks. Lenox Square and Phipps Plaza anchor the retail core, and the office towers, hotels and high-rise condos of the Buckhead district ring them. The towing profile follows the money. Newer and higher-value vehicles mean flatbed-only requests and owners who expect careful handling, and the shopping centers, office decks and hotel lots generate private-property tows governed by O.C.G.A. 44-1-13 and the Georgia DPS Maximum Rate Tariff No. 5, which caps a non-consensual tow of a vehicle under 10,000 pounds at $228 and daily storage at $33, with no storage fee for the first 24 hours. Piedmont Atlanta hospital sits on the Buckhead-Midtown line and adds accident-tow context. If a car goes missing from a Buckhead lot, the sign, distance and rate rules in the state tariff all matter to what you can be charged. Does my motorcycle need a flatbed instead of a chock in Buckhead?

A flatbed is the right call for a bike that won't sit upright safely, a low-clearance sport bike, or anything with fairing damage. In Buckhead the assigned operator confirms the method on the call and quotes the flatbed rate up front if that's what the bike needs.
